Abstract
During an evacuation situation in a building equipped with an elevator system, in which building a plurality of fixed point markers are arranged at specified locations, a sequence of floors (L1, L2, L3) to be evacuated according to which the elevator system services the floors (L1, L2, L3) is determined. The sequence depends on the current traffic situations on the floors (L1, L2, L3). The traffic situation is, in turn, based on the instantaneous positions of the mobile devices. These positions are each determined in each case when a mobile device, by means of data received from a first fixed point marker, accesses a database in which the data is linked to a site of the first fixed point marker.
